Bootstrap右手侧边栏不够长

时间:2018-04-17 13:45:34

标签: twitter-bootstrap-3

道歉,如果这是非常基本的,但我有一个问题,一个自举右侧边栏没有占据整个右手区域。单独div区域中的图像与此侧栏重叠。如果我向侧边栏添加更多内容,它就会变成废话。
如何让两个较小的图像占据与div-col-med-8相同的宽度。也许我正在以错误的方式看待这个,我正在学习HTML CSS等,所以我有点困惑 非常感谢任何帮助。

这是网站的链接

http://vigilant-bardeen-58c461.bitballoon.com/

这是dropboxlink

https://www.dropbox.com/s/1i0qfpijgekvdfj/newsweek.zip?dl=0

由于
尼尔

1 个答案:

答案 0 :(得分:0)

    <!DOCTYPE html>
<html lang="en">
  <!-- Head -->
  <head>
    <title>Newsweek</title>

    <link href="css/bootstrap.min.css" rel="stylesheet">
    <link href="css/navbar.css" rel="stylesheet">
    <link href="css/main.css" rel="stylesheet">
    <link href="css/sidebar.css" rel="stylesheet">
  </head>

  <!-- Body -->
  <body>
    <!-- Navbar -->
    <nav class="topnav navbar navbar-inverse navbar-static-top" role="navigation">
      <div class="container">
        <div class="navbar-header hidden-xs">
          <a href="#" class="pull-left">
            <img class="visible-sm visible-lg" src="images/logo/logo_lg.svg" alt="">
            <img class="visible-md" src="images/logo/logo-sm.svg" alt="">
          </a>
        </div>
        <ul class="nav navbar-nav navbar-left nav-items visible-md visible-lg">
          <li><a href="#">U.S.</a></li>
          <li><a href="#">WORLD</a></li>
          <li><a href="#">BUSINESS</a></li>
          <li><a href="#">TECH & SCIENCE</a></li>
          <li><a href="#" class="glyphicon glyphicon-search"></a></li>
        </ul>
        <div id="navbar" class="navbar-collapse collapse">
          <a href="#" class="pull-left">
            <img class="visible-xs" src="images/logo/logo-sm.svg" alt="">
          </a>
          <!-- Smaller Screen Nav Bar -->
          <ul class="nav navbar-nav navbar-right hidden-lg hidden-md">
            <li class="divider-vertical"></li>
            <li class="dropdown dropdown-style">
              <a href="#" id="search-box" class="dropdown-toggle glyphicon glyphicon-search" data-toggle="dropdown"></a>
              <div class="banner-width-set">
              </div>
            </li>
            <li class="divider-vertical"></li>
            <li class="dropdown dropdown-style-sm-hamburger">
              <a href="#" id="hamburger" class="dropdown-toggle glyphicon glyphicon-menu-hamburger" data-toggle="dropdown"></a>
              <div class="banner-width-set">
              </div>
            </li>
          </ul>
          <!-- lg Screen Nav Bar -->
          <ul class="nav navbar-nav navbar-right visible-lg visible-md">
            <li class="divider-vertical"></li>
            <li class="dropdown">
              <a href="#" id="circular-image" class="dropdown-toggle" data-toggle="dropdown">
                <div class="banner-subscribe-to">
                  <div class="wrapper">
                    <p><img class="img-circle" src="images/navbar/nav-bar-img.jpg">
                      <span>Subscribe <br> To Newsweek</span>
                    </p>
                  </div>
                </div>
              </a>
            </li>
            <li class="divider-vertical"></li>
            <li class="dropdown dropdown-style">
              <a href="#" id="map-marker" class="dropdown-toggle glyphicon glyphicon-map-marker" data-toggle="dropdown"></a>
            </li>
            <li class="divider-vertical"></li>
            <li><a href="#">Sign In</a>
              <div class="banner-sign-in">
              </div>
            </li>
          </ul>
        </div>
      </div>
    </nav>

    <div class="container main-content">
      <div class="row">

        <div class="col-md-8">
          <img src="images/main/main_main.jpg" class=" main-image img-responsive"   alt="news reader">
        <!--Main-->
        </div>

<div class="row">
        <div class="col-md-4 sidebar ">
        <!--Side Menu-->
        <h1 class="headlines-title text-left">Latest Headlines</h1>
          <ul>

            <li class="latest-headlines"> <span class="bullet-text">Watch: Gorilla Gives Birth to First Son Moke</span></li>
            <hr>
            <li class="latest-headlines"> <span class="bullet-text">Woman Charged Over Attack on Pregnant Service Woman</li>
               <hr>
            <li class="latest-headlines"> <span class="bullet-text">'Sick and Tired of Being Babied': Embiid Lashes out</li>
               <hr>
            <li class="latest-headlines"> <span class="bullet-text">Syrian Independence Day: Facts on Freedom from France</li>
               <hr>
            <li class="latest-headlines"><span class="bullet-text">‘The Terror’ Episode 5: The Tuunbaq Attacks</li>
               <hr>
            <li class="latest-headlines"><span class="bullet-text">White Evangelical Support for Trump Grows</li>
              <hr>

            <li class="latest-headlines"><span class="bullet-text">White Evangelical Support for Trump Grows</li>


          </ul>
          <button type="button" class="btn btn-primary btn-block">See All Headlines</button>
        </div>

      </div>
    </div>

    </div>

    <!-- ******* more content ***** -->

      <div class="container more-content">
        <div class="row">

        <div class="col-md-8">
          <h3> <span class="country-header text-center" >U.S</span></h3>
          <h4>JUSTICE DEPARTMENT TO FORCE REFORMS</h4>
          <h5>Residents of Ferguson have waited nearly a year for their city to adopt the agreement. </h5>
        <!--Main-->
        </div>
        <div class="container more-content">
          <div class="row">
          <div class="col-md-6">
            <div class="content">
              <img src="images/main/main1.png" alt="man on sinking car" class="img-thumbnail">
            </div>
          </div>

        <div class="row">
          <div class="col-md-6"></div>
           <div class="content">
          <img src="images/main/main2.jpg" alt="asian university photo" class="img-thumbnail">
        </div>
         </div>

</div>


    <!-- Bootstrap core JavaScript
    ================================================== -->
    <!-- Placed at the end of the document so the pages load faster -->
    <script src="js/jquery.min.js"></script>
    <script src="js/bootstrap.min.js"></script>
  </body>
</html>